Global marketing consultancy Added Value, part of STW Group, today announced the promotion of Dennis Wong to the position of Managing Director, Australia.

One of the country’s leading brand development and insight specialists, Wong first joined Added Value Australia in 2008.  He has since led partnerships with businesses including Diageo, McDonald’s and Goodman Fielder.

“Dennis has been a key part in the impressive performance of Added Value. The Australian office produces some of the most outstanding work of any Added Value office in the world.  Dennis deserves a lot of credit and is the perfect guy to follow in James Pike’s footsteps,” said STW Group CEO Michael Connaghan.

Wong replaces James Pike as MD, following his move to fellow STW Group agency Bohemia.  He will lead the Added Value business with an exceptionally experienced and talented Director team including Mark Kennedy, Sally Smallman and Colin McArthur.  McArthur joined Added Value in June from Jigsaw.

“Added Value has a team which gets a kick out of finding new ways to look at the world. It’s a real privilege to be part of such an agile business in the world of marketing today,” said Wong.

“The entire construct of where and how brands need to find growth has changed. Constantly playing with new thinking, philosophies and approaches to grow becomes a burning platform for businesses which really echoes who we are and what we love to do.”

Added Value is a world leading marketing consultancy, specialising in transforming businesses through actionable insight, portfolio and positioning and innovation.   In Australia, Added Value is part of STW, Australasia’s leading marketing content and communications group.
